The objective of this study is to anticipate the social and legal implications of the Knight v. Trump court decision. This will be done through a content analysis of the U.S. House of Representatives’ Twitter accounts compared with President Trump’s Twitter account. The goal of the analysis is to determine what activity constitutes “governmental functions” as defined by Judge Buchwald in the Knight v. Trump court opinion. Through content analysis, this study will clarify what actions warrant the classification of a Twitter account as a designated public forum and to predict how Knight v. Trump may change the ways public officials utilize their online platforms.
